还剩9页未读,继续阅读
本资源只提供10页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
文本内容:
网页基础经典试题附带答案
一、单选题
1.在HTML中,用于创建超链接的标签是()(1分)A.imgB.aC.divD.span【答案】B【解析】a标签用于创建超链接
2.下列哪个CSS属性用于设置文本颜色?()(1分)A.text-alignB.colorC.font-sizeD.text-decoration【答案】B【解析】color属性用于设置文本颜色
3.在JavaScript中,用于输出信息的函数是()(1分)A.inputB.outputC.console.logD.print【答案】C【解析】console.log用于输出信息
4.以下哪个HTML标签是块级元素?()(1分)A.imgB.spanC.pD.a【答案】C【解析】p标签是块级元素
5.在CSS中,用于设置元素的外边距的属性是()(1分)A.paddingB.marginC.borderD.border-radius【答案】B【解析】margin属性用于设置元素的外边距
6.以下哪个HTTP方法用于提交表单数据?()(1分)A.GETB.POSTC.PUTD.DELETE【答案】B【解析】POST方法用于提交表单数据
7.在HTML中,用于设置标题的标签是()(1分)A.h1B.headerC.titleD.heading【答案】A【解析】h1标签用于设置标题
8.在JavaScript中,用于定义变量的关键字是()(1分)A.varB.variableC.vD.let【答案】A【解析】var是定义变量的关键字
9.以下哪个CSS属性用于设置元素的宽度?()(1分)A.heightB.widthC.sizeD.length【答案】B【解析】width属性用于设置元素的宽度
10.在HTML中,用于创建无序列表的标签是()(1分)A.olB.ulC.dlD.list【答案】B【解析】ul标签用于创建无序列表
二、多选题(每题4分,共20分)
1.以下哪些是HTML的基本标签?()A.htmlB.bodyC.headD.footerE.header【答案】A、B、C【解析】HTML的基本标签包括html、body和head
2.以下哪些CSS属性用于设置文本样式?()A.colorB.font-sizeC.text-alignD.text-decorationE.background-color【答案】A、B、C、D【解析】color、font-size、text-align和text-decoration用于设置文本样式
3.在JavaScript中,以下哪些是数据类型?()A.StringB.NumberC.BooleanD.ObjectE.Array【答案】A、B、C、D、E【解析】JavaScript的数据类型包括String、Number、Boolean、Object和Array
4.以下哪些HTTP方法用于安全地提交表单数据?()A.GETB.POSTC.PUTD.DELETEE.GET【答案】B【解析】POST方法用于安全地提交表单数据
5.以下哪些是CSS选择器?()A.id选择器B.class选择器C.tag选择器D.attribute选择器Eпсевдоэлемент【答案】A、B、C、D、E【解析】CSS选择器包括id选择器、class选择器、tag选择器、attribute选择器和псевдоэлемент
三、填空题
1.HTML文件的根元素是______(2分)【答案】html
2.CSS中,用于设置元素的内边距的属性是______(2分)【答案】padding
3.JavaScript中,用于声明函数的关键字是______(2分)【答案】function
4.HTTP协议中,用于获取资源的请求方法是______(2分)【答案】GET
5.在HTML中,用于创建有序列表的标签是______(2分)【答案】ol
四、判断题
1.在HTML中,br标签用于换行()(2分)【答案】(√)【解析】br标签用于换行
2.CSS中,属性选择器用表示()(2分)【答案】(×)【解析】属性选择器用[]表示
3.JS中,var和let都可以用于声明变量()(2分)【答案】(√)【解析】var和let都可以用于声明变量
4.HTTP协议中,POST方法比GET方法更安全()(2分)【答案】(√)【解析】POST方法比GET方法更安全
5.CSS中,margin和padding是同一个概念()(2分)【答案】(×)【解析】margin和padding是不同的概念,margin是外边距,padding是内边距
五、简答题
1.简述HTML、CSS和JavaScript之间的关系(4分)【答案】HTML用于构建网页的结构,CSS用于设置网页的样式,JavaScript用于实现网页的交互功能三者共同构成了网页的前端技术
2.解释什么是HTTP协议及其主要方法(5分)【答案】HTTP协议是超文本传输协议,是互联网上应用最为广泛的一种网络协议主要方法包括GET、POST、PUT、DELETE等,分别用于获取资源、提交表单数据、更新资源和删除资源
3.描述CSS中盒模型的概念及其组成部分(5分)【答案】CSS盒模型包括内容content、内边距padding、边框border和外边距margin四个部分内容是元素的实际内容,内边距是内容与边框之间的空间,边框是围绕内容的线条,外边距是元素与其他元素之间的空间
六、分析题
1.分析一个简单的网页结构,包括HTML结构、CSS样式和JavaScript交互(10分)【答案】HTML结构```html!DOCTYPEhtmlhtmlheadtitle简单网页/titlelinkrel=stylesheettype=text/csshref=style.css/headbodyh1欢迎来到我的网页/h1p这是一个简单的网页示例/pbuttononclick=alert点击了按钮点击我/buttonscriptsrc=script.js/script/body/html```CSS样式```cssh1{color:blue;text-align:center;}p{font-size:16px;color:green;}button{background-color:red;color:white;padding:10px20px;border:none;border-radius:5px;cursor:pointer;}button:hover{background-color:darkred;}```JavaScript交互```javascriptfunctionshowAlert{alert点击了按钮;}```
七、综合应用题
1.设计一个简单的网页,包括标题、段落、列表和按钮,并使用CSS设置样式和JavaScript实现按钮点击事件(25分)【答案】HTML结构```html!DOCTYPEhtmlhtmlheadtitle简单网页示例/titlelinkrel=stylesheettype=text/csshref=style.css/headbodyh1欢迎来到我的网页/h1p这是一个简单的网页示例/pulli列表项1/lili列表项2/lili列表项3/li/ulbuttonid=myButton点击我/buttonscriptsrc=script.js/script/body/html```CSS样式```cssh1{color:blue;text-align:center;}p{font-size:16px;color:green;}ul{list-style-type:none;padding:0;}li{margin-bottom:10px;}button{background-color:red;color:white;padding:10px20px;border:none;border-radius:5px;cursor:pointer;}button:hover{background-color:darkred;}```JavaScript交互```javascriptdocument.getElementByIdmyButton.addEventListenerclick,function{alert点击了按钮;};```
八、标准答案
一、单选题
1.B
2.B
3.C
4.C
5.B
6.B
7.A
8.A
9.B
10.B
二、多选题
1.A、B、C
2.A、B、C、D
3.A、B、C、D、E
4.B
5.A、B、C、D、E
三、填空题
1.html
2.padding
3.function
4.GET
5.ol
四、判断题
1.(√)
2.(×)
3.(√)
4.(√)
5.(×)
五、简答题
1.见答案
2.见答案
3.见答案
六、分析题
1.见答案
七、综合应用题
1.见答案请注意,以上内容符合百度文库审核标准,不包含任何敏感信息,且内容原创、专业、实用。
个人认证
优秀文档
获得点赞 0